The Lexus ES 300h is a midsize premium hybrid sedan combining a 2.5-liter four-cylinder petrol engine with a powerful electric motor to produce a combined 218 PS and 221 Nm of torque. It uses an electronically controlled continuously variable transmission (e-CVT) powering the front wheels, offering smooth acceleration and efficiency. The vehicle rides on the GA-K platform, providing a comfortable, controlled ride and good handling. Interior features include a spacious leather-upholstered cabin with ventilated front seats, a large 12.3-inch touchscreen infotainment system with wireless Apple CarPlay and Android Auto, a 17-speaker Mark Levinson premium sound system, heads-up display, and tri-zone climate control. Safety is paramount with a standard 10-airbag setup, adaptive cruise control, lane tracing assist, blind spot monitoring, and more under the Lexus Safety System+. The design features sleek triple-beam LED headlamps, a streamlined coupe-like roofline, and stylish alloy wheels that enhance both aesthetics and aerodynamics. With 454 liters of boot space and a focus on comfort and tech, it is positioned well for luxury car buyers wanting hybrid performance in India.

Pricing details and changes
The Lexus ES 300h is available in India with two variants, the Exquisite at ₹62.65 lakh and the Luxury at ₹68.23 lakh, both ex-showroom. On-road prices will vary depending on the city, but expect to pay between ₹70 lakh and ₹77 lakh for the Luxury variant, factoring in registration, insurance, and other charges. The pricing positions the ES 300h as a premium offering, but it delivers value through its hybrid powertrain, advanced safety, and luxury features. The Luxury variant justifies its higher price with extras like the Mark Levinson sound system, reclining rear seats, and more detailed wheel designs. For buyers seeking a chauffeur-driven experience or those who want the best in comfort and tech, the ES 300h’s price is competitive within its segment, especially when considering the long-term benefits of hybrid ownership.
The Lexus ES 300h is priced at approximately INR 62.65 lakh ex-showroom in India for the Exquisite variant, with the Luxury variant commanding around INR 68.23 lakh ex-showroom. On-road prices vary between cities due to differing state taxes, typically adding INR 4-6 lakh depending on location, so one can expect an on-road price roughly between INR 67 lakh and INR 74 lakh. This places the ES 300h firmly in the premium luxury hybrid sedan segment, competing against European rivals like the Mercedes-Benz E-Class and Audi A6. The pricing reflects its cutting-edge hybrid powertrain, rich feature set including advanced driver aids and premium cabin materials, plus Lexus' strong global reputation for reliability and refinement. Fuel efficiency information
The Lexus ES 300h offers an impressive mileage of around 22 kmpl in real-world Indian conditions, making it one of the most fuel-efficient luxury sedans in its class. This hybrid powertrain ensures lower running costs and fewer visits to the fuel station, which is a significant advantage for those concerned about long-term expenses. The combination of petrol and electric power allows for smooth city driving and efficient highway cruising, making it a practical choice for both daily commutes and long journeys.
